Diversion Program offered at Community Action of Skagit County

330 Pacific Place, Mount Vernon, WA 98273

Eligibility
Literally homeless, no income limit. At-risk of homelessness, 50% AMI.
Hours
9am to 4pm from Monday through Friday
Application process
Call 360-416-7585 and ask for Diversion Program, or visit in person.
Fees
None.
Service area
Skagit, WA
Short-term program (60 days) to help divert clients from entering intensive programs like Coordinated Entry. Services are to exit people out of homelessness or prevent them from becoming unhoused. Problem-solving services offered and on occasion, one-time financial assistance to households that can utilized their own resources to sustain housing.

Providing organization
Community Action of Skagit County
A community-based non-profit organization offering a wide variety of services.  The primary purpose is to help low-income persons reach, or maintain, self-sufficiency. The agency has eight impact areas: Family Stability, Housing, Financial Stability, Employment, Education and Literacy, Health, Food and Nutrition, and Community Engagement and Volunteerism.
